FDA Issues Complete Response Letter for Bitopertin NDA, Citing Lack of Clinical Benefit Association

Disc Medicine received a Complete Response Letter from the FDA for its New Drug Application for bitopertin, delaying approval due to insufficient evidence linking the surrogate endpoint to clinical benefit. The company will now rely on its ongoing Phase 3 APOLLO study for potential traditional approval, with results expected in Q4 2026.

  • FDA Issues Complete Response Letter (CRL)

    The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) issued a Complete Response Letter for the New Drug Application (NDA) for bitopertin as a treatment for erythropoietic protoporphyria (EPP).

  • Lack of Clinical Benefit Association Cited

    The FDA acknowledged that bitopertin significantly lowers PPIX (a surrogate endpoint) but concluded that submitted trials (AURORA and BEACON) did not show evidence of association between PPIX changes and sunlight exposure-based clinical endpoints.

  • Reliance on Ongoing Phase 3 APOLLO Study

    The FDA indicated that results from the ongoing Phase 3 APOLLO study could serve as evidence to support traditional approval, with topline data anticipated in Q4 2026.

  • Delayed Approval Timeline

    The CRL will delay potential approval, with a response to the CRL planned after APOLLO completion and an updated FDA decision expected by mid-2027.

The FDA's Complete Response Letter (CRL) for bitopertin's New Drug Application represents a significant setback for Disc Medicine, delaying the potential market entry of a key pipeline asset. While the FDA acknowledged bitopertin's ability to lower PPIX, the lack of demonstrated association between this surrogate endpoint and clinical benefit in the submitted trials (AURORA and BEACON) is a critical issue. The path forward now relies on the ongoing Phase 3 APOLLO study, pushing a potential FDA decision to mid-2027. This introduces substantial uncertainty and extends the timeline for commercialization, which will likely weigh on investor sentiment. The company's strong cash position, previously disclosed on January 12, 2026, provides a financial buffer to continue development through this extended period.
